Cocoa (NeXT's/Apple's framework for Objective-C) uses a very successful and well-thought-out delegation pattern, whereby GUI elements representing large amounts of data, like table views, have delegates (not in the D sense of the word) that provide them with the actual contents. Granted, Objective-C's runtime is much more dynamic than D, but a simplified version of such a pattern could still work in D. After all, user interfacing is typically where dynamism is more important than speed.
